Broken Tracks If the tracks of your sliding patio doors are bent or kinked it can cause the door to hang, jam, or even jump off when you open or close it. The bent tracks are usually simple to fix yourself but you'll require the right tools to accomplish this task properly. First, determine whether the track bends inward or outward. If it bends inside itself it is easy to pull it back in place with pliers. If it bends inwards you'll require a block and a rubber mallet. Use the rubber mallet, since metal can scratch. After straightening the track, you should lubricate it to prevent it from being bent again. Regular lubrication can also help keep the track in place between the door and the frame to stop leaks from developing around it. It is essential to determine the source of the leak prior to hire a professional to repair or replace your patio door. This will stop the growth of mildew, mold and other moisture-related problems. If you're unsure of where the water is coming from then spray it with a garden hose to identify the areas that are affected. From there you can plan your repair or replacement accordingly. Water that leaks from the bottom of the door's frame typically indicates that the threshold or sill pan needs to be replaced or replaced. Different types of locks are used on patio doors, and each one has a particular size and shape that needs to match the frame of your home in order to fit correctly. It is possible to replace the locking mechanism on your patio door with a new one, but this takes a lot of work and is often more costly than just getting the right components for the existing lock. The most commonly used lock assembly for patio doors is the E2105 mortise latch. It is readily available at a variety of hardware stores in a assortment of finishes and colors. This assembly includes an E2014 mortise latch as well as a recessed housing, the escutcheon plate as well as a lock hasp. If the E2014 mortise lock part breaks, it is possible to purchase the broken part. Be sure to go online before purchasing the entire assembly. There are a few DIY surface mounted patio door locks that are compatible with all aluminum or wooden patio doors. These locks require an opening of a rectangular shape in the patio panel for the hasp and mounting screws between the keyway and above it. It is essential to select the right lock for your patio doors. There are two types that come with an incline keyway and the other with a 45 degree keyway. The most frequent issue with these assemblies is that the latch will not stay latched. This is caused by the patio door not being square with the frame and the side jambs of your home. This can be fixed by opening the patio door and checking the edges to ensure it is straight and parallel with the frame. If you have a patio door that isn't easy to open and close, this may be because of dirt and debris that has accumulated on the tracks. This issue can be easily solved by thoroughly cleaning the tracks and applying a lubricant. Regularly applying lubricant to the tracks and rollers will help to prevent the problems of sticking and misalignment. The frame of your sliding patio door may be affected by a range of issues, including splintering and rotting. This can compromise the structural integrity of your patio door and make it vulnerable to pests. If the frame of your patio door is severely damaged, it could be time to consider the replacement.
